Leronlimab
go.drugbank.com/drugs/DB05941InvestigationalLeronlimab, or PRO-140, is a human monoclonal antibody developed by CytoDyn. It was first described in the literature in 2001. This antibody binds to CCR5, which may be useful in treating HIV, cancers, and severely ill COVID-19 patients.
Isometheptene
go.drugbank.com/drugs/DB06706ApprovedIsometheptene is a sympathomimetic drug that causes vasoconstriction. It is used for treating migraines and tension headaches.

Idebenone
go.drugbank.com/drugs/DB09081ApprovedInvestigationalDue to its biochemical mode of action, it's thought that idebenone may re-activate viable-but-inactive retinal ganglion cells (RGCs) in LHON patients [L885]. … Due to its ability to reduce oxidative damage and improve ATP production, idebenone was originally investigated for its potential use in Alzheimer's Disease and other cognitivie disorders [A19769].
